Discover a unique opportunity to be part of the rich history of Key West at the Key West Historic Inns Collection. Formerly known as Kimpton Key West, our historic collection boasts 219 guestrooms across Winslow’s Bungalows, Lighthouse Hotel, Ridley House, Ella’s Cottages, and Fitch Lodge. These buildings, originally homes for army officers, industrialists, and steamboat captains, reflect architectural styles from Conch to Queen Anne. Built when Key West was Florida's largest city in 1900, each structure holds captivating stories of gold discoveries and vaudeville performances.
